    Organization Level

    Organization Level is the process of aligning data from different sources and systems to ensure consistency and compatibility. This is often done through business process reengineering and the use of international data models.

    1. Data Mapping: Mapping data from different sources to a common set of standards facilitates integration and enhances data quality.
    2. APIs: Application Programming Interfaces allow for seamless data communication between systems, providing real-time access and reducing data silos.
    3. ETL Tools: Extract, Transform, and Load tools automate the process of moving and transforming data, saving time and reducing errors.
    4. Master Data Management: Creating a single source of truth for key data entities ensures consistency and accuracy across systems.
    5. Data Governance: Implementing a data governance framework ensures proper management, access, and usage of data across the organization.
    6. Cloud Recovery Period: Using cloud-based solutions allows for easier and faster integration of data from various sources, regardless of location.
    7. Data Quality Assessment: Checking data quality before integration helps identify any issues and fix them to ensure accurate and reliable data.
    8. Real-time Data Replication: Replicating data in real-time allows for up-to-date information and eliminates the need for manual data updates.
    9. Data Virtualization: This approach creates a virtual layer that integrates data from multiple sources without physically moving it, reducing redundancy and enhancing data agility.
    10. Collaborative Data Sharing: Encouraging collaboration and sharing of data within and outside the organization promotes a holistic view of data, leading to better insights and decision-making.

    Organization Level Case Study/Use Case example - How to use:



    Client Situation:

    ABC Corporation is a multinational organization that specializes in manufacturing and selling consumer electronics. The company operates in various countries across the world, with each country having its own set of data systems and processes. This has resulted in data fragmentation, duplication, and inconsistency, leading to inefficiency and increased operational costs for the organization.

    The top management at ABC Corporation recognized the need to harmonize their data systems and processes to improve their business operations and gain a competitive advantage. They understood that Organization Level would allow them to have a single source of truth and provide real-time insights, helping them make informed decisions and enhance the overall customer experience.

    Consulting Methodology:

    To address the client′s needs, our consulting firm proposed a comprehensive business process reengineering (BPR) and Organization Level project. Our approach involved the following steps:

    1. Understanding the client′s current state: We conducted a detailed assessment of the client′s existing data systems, processes, and organizational structure. This helped us identify the pain points and challenges faced by the organization.

    2. Identifying the international data model: We researched and analyzed various data models used in the industry and recommended an international data model that best suited the client′s business needs.

    3. Developing a harmonization roadmap: Based on the identified data model, we developed a roadmap outlining the steps to be taken to harmonize the existing data systems. This included identifying the key stakeholders, mapping the data elements, and establishing data governance policies.

    4. Implementation of the harmonization plan: We worked closely with the client′s IT team to implement the harmonization plan, which involved data cleansing, consolidation, and integration processes. We also provided training to the end-users to ensure a smooth adoption of the new processes and systems.

    5. Continuous monitoring and maintenance: Once the Organization Level was completed, we continued to monitor the data systems and processes to ensure they were functioning effectively. Any issues or challenges were addressed promptly to maintain the quality and consistency of data.

    Deliverables:

    1. Business process reengineering plan: A detailed report outlining the current state of the client′s data systems, key challenges, and proposed reengineering plan.

    2. Harmonization roadmap: A comprehensive roadmap that provided a step-by-step approach to harmonize the data systems and processes, along with timelines and budget estimations.

    3. Harmonized data systems: Consolidated and integrated data systems, ensuring data quality and consistency across the organization.

    4. Data governance policies: Guidelines and protocols for managing and governing data to ensure its accuracy, consistency, and security.

    Implementation Challenges:

    The implementation of Organization Level posed several challenges, including:

    1. Resistance to change: The adoption of new data systems and processes required a significant cultural shift, which faced resistance from some employees.

    2. Budget and resource constraints: The project involved significant investments in terms of time and resources. Budget constraints initially posed a challenge for the organization.

    3. Technical complexities: Integrating different data systems and mapping data elements proved to be technically challenging, requiring dedicated effort from the IT team.

    Key Performance Indicators (KPIs):

    1. Cost reduction: The primary objective of the project was to reduce operational costs by removing redundancies and inconsistencies in data systems. A decrease in overall expenses was measured to assess the success of the project.

    2. Time savings: We aimed to reduce the time taken to perform data-related tasks by streamlining the processes. A reduction in the time taken to generate reports and access data was measured to determine the project′s effectiveness.

    3. Data accuracy: Through Organization Level, we expected to improve the accuracy and consistency of data across the organization. The number of errors and discrepancies in data were measured to evaluate the project′s success.

    Management Considerations:

    The success of the Organization Level project relied heavily on the organization′s management commitment and involvement. Some key considerations for the management to ensure a successful implementation include:

    1. Providing adequate resources: The management should prioritize the project by providing the necessary budget and resources.

    2. Promoting a positive culture: It is essential to encourage a positive attitude towards change within the organization to overcome any resistance to the new data systems and processes.

    3. Ensuring clear communication: Effective communication from the management team can help create buy-in for the project and facilitate a smooth transition.
